    Parents access to students grades

    Hi All,

    What is the best way to implement access to student grades for parents.

    A couple of options for you to get started with.

    If you use SIMS - you could look at Sims Learning Gateway

    SIMS Learning Gateway

    or another alternative is the TASC product

    Insight

    People on this site use both products succesfully.

    I assume you mean the Edugeek Joomla package? If so, then no, there is no MIS integration for Joomla at the moment - it is purely a content management system. All the products listed above are either standalone, sharepoint based or moodle modules.

    Quote Originally Posted by usmn01 View Post
    The other question I would like to ask you is what products do you recommend for new school website project?
    It really depends on what you want to present to parents. We currently have a basic website which presents information for parents and visitors only. In the future, we intend to move to an entirely sharepoint based site, with parental/staff/pupil/governors logins available to allow easy separation of the different bits of information that we want to post online.

    The choice of the 'platform' to do this is very much guided by the goals of the site.

    Quote Originally Posted by usmn01 View Post
    What is the best way to implement access to student grades for parents.
    Get your MIS to export grades data, write something to haul it in to Joomla for you. If you're using SIMS, that means exporting XML data via CommandReporter and writing something to read that.
